The Role:
The Account Manager will report to the State Manager - NSW and will be responsible for being the main point of contact for clients and will be responsible for ensuring all projects are delivered to the clients sat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ities include;
- Acting as the main client interface
- Scoping client’s properties & gathering technical information
- Briefing team on the scope of works
- Overseeing concept development with the design team
- Assembling proposals & project documents
- Conducting client presentations
- Assisting Project Manager to organise client infrastructure & site preparation
- Attending project installation, conducting audits on dismantling and assisting Project Manager (on-site where required)
- Updating clients on project progress and dealing with any problems swiftly
- Possessing supreme knowledge of the company's product range and services
- Identifying and growing opportunities within the territory
- Achieving sales targets
- Managing client records
- The production of weekly reports & schedules
